Nasen Saadi, 21, from Croydon, is being sentenced after being discovered responsible of murdering Amie Gray and trying to homicide Leanne Miles on a seaside in Bournemouth.

Saadi stabbed private coach Amie, 34, 10 instances as she sat beside a fireplace on Durley Chine Beach in Dorset on the night of 24 May 2024.

The criminology scholar had researched areas to hold out the killing and had even requested his course lecturers questions on how you can get away with homicide
